Original statement

SSUH.E.36.d: explain how the significance of slavery grew in American politics including slave rebellions and the rise of abolitionism using primary and secondary sources (e.g., Nat Turner, writings of Frederick Douglass, Sojourner Truth, William Lloyd Garrison, etc.)
